I am having this same issue. I think it has to do with Magisk v22. When it is updating, it will find the Magisk addon.d script and run it, but it complains that it can't find the Magisk Manager APK and it then fails to path the boot image. I have the Magisk APK in the same folder as the Lineage update .zip and I also have it in my top-level /sdcard directory and I also have it copied using the new "renaming to Magisk.zip", but it still complains that it can't find that APK.
I have tried the 03-08-2021 Lineage and the 03-16-2021 updates and I have the same problem with both. What ends up happening is the update succeeds, then it runs addon.d for NikGapps, which looks fine. Then it runs addon.d for Magisk, which reports the failure to find the Magisk APK, but seems to work otherwise.
When I boot after the update (dirty flash), it fails to get to System. It will bootloop into recovery mode.
What fixes it for me is that I reflash the ROM update, then NikGapps, then Magisk. Then it will boot just fine.
When I do it this way the second time, NikGapps no longer has any addon.d that happens as it does in the first dirty flash.
